I took this from the back balcony of my house this afternoon. It is a RAAF F/A-18 Hornet doing a track fly-over for the Clipsal 500 Rally in Adelaide, Australia, this weekend. I heard the plane, and barely managed to run upstairs, change lenses, and get a few shots off from the balcony. This image is cropped right down, hence the poor resolution. I did some minimal post-processing (levels, sharpening). It's hardly an exceptional shot, just something interesting to see from the back of my house.

Canon EOS 20D, EF 55-200mm at 200mm, 1/1600, f/5.7, ISO 400.
